Fluid crane shots and dynamic flythroughs make the assembly process visually engaging. Using slow-motion during key moments, like major connections, adds emphasis. When adjusting camera settings, try incorporating more dramatic angles or close-ups to enhance engagement.4. Lighting
Lighting is critical. The scenes use self-lit elements and glowing projections against a dark backdrop. This technique adds depth and intrigue. If you're experimenting, consider using colored lighting to create different moods. For instance, a blue hue can evoke a techy feel, while warmer tones can create a more inviting atmosphere.5. Audio
Sound design is as important as visuals. The shimmering chimes and deep hums create a rich auditory experience. If you’re working with audio, aim for a blend of ambient sounds that complement the visuals. - Experiment with Lighting: Try different light colors for various scenes to see how they affect mood.
- Vary Camera Angles: Use a mix of wide shots and close-ups to keep the visuals dynamic.
- Sound Syncing: Ensure your audio cues match the visual actions for a more immersive experience.
- Keep It Simple: Don’t overcrowd scenes with too many effects; sometimes, less is more.
